🤯confound

verb
/kənˈfaʊnd/

意味

to confuse or surprise someone, often by acting against their expectations

例文

The magician's trick seemed to confound the entire audience.

表現例

confound it

同義語

bewilder, perplex, baffle, amaze, astonish

対義語

clarify, explain, enlighten

コロケーション

confound expectations, confound critics, confound logic, confound the mind
